Requirements

  • Python 3.8+
  • Install ffmpeg, and have avaliable on your path
  • WARNING On Linux you need to run pip install aubio BEFORE the below command. All other OS's should be fine
  • pip install -r requirements.txt

TLDR: Running locally (not on the rasberry pi, just on your computer in your terminal)

  • example 1, start the light show "shelter" locally (terminal UI).
    • python light_server.py --show shelter
  • example 2, start the show hooked with 7% volume locally (terminal UI), skip to beat 30.
    • python light_server.py --volume 7 --show butter --skip 30

Using the UI

To use the UI, the terminal commands above will output something like:

Dj interface: http://YOUR_IP:9555/dj.html
Queue: http://YOUR_IP:9555

Just copy either into your browser, and you'll be able to control the show from there.

Autogeneration

Putting a parameter after --autogen fuzzy finds the song filename

python light_server.py --autogen shelter

No parameter autogenerates all songs

python light_server.py --autogen

--autogen_mode options

  • both [DEFAULT] - autogenerates both normal and laser modes
  • normal - autogenerates normal
  • lasers - autogenerates laser mode
  • simple - autogenerates simple RBBB 1 bar for song

Getting songs

download song from youtube and make show file (auto finds BPM and offset)

python youtube_helpers.py "YOUTUBE_URL_HERE"

if you just want the song and dont want to generate show (unlikely), then run

python youtube_helpers.py --no_show "YOUTUBE_URL_HERE"

To get all songs from doorbell

It should be pretty good about auto downloading specific songs with the --show parameter (run it and see what it says), but to download all songs, run: scp -r pi@doorbell:/home/pi/light-show/songs .

To push your songs TO the doorbell

scp -r songs pi@doorbell:/home/pi/light-show/

copy generated shows to doorbell

scp -r effects/autogen_shows doorbell:/home/pi/light-show/effects/autogen_shows
